Government Innovation Fellow
-Supported the implementation of the largest guaranteed income project attempted in America (Chicago Resilient Communities Pilot), providing 5,000 low-income households 500 dollars monthly for one year.-Developed action-oriented frameworks that translated city, community, research, and end user values to a set of recommendations that determined pilot’s target population, eligibility requirements, and evaluation priorities. -Synthesized extensive research of 50+ active guaranteed income pilots to develop a program implementation toolkit and tailor a specific strategy to preserve existing benefits for participants.-Drafted Request-For-Proposals awarding $31.5 million to outreach and administration vendors, relying on knowledge of procurement best practices and subject areas expertise, to attract diverse, creative, and competitive delegate submissions. -Created a performance management strategy and process analyzing 175,000 applications to identify and spread effective outreach strategies that increased the share of Latinx applications 6.7 percentage points.-Executed a series of eight 90-minute workshops, communicating promising innovations in social service delivery and identifying partnership opportunities with 40 jurisdictions considering how to invest American Rescue Plan funds.
